Patch Review

Straightforward mechanical change. The guard is now named `guard` (not `_guard`), and `&*guard` dereferences the `UnbindGuard` to get `&T::ParentDevice<device::Bound>`:

```rust
-                            match $func(dev, data, file) {
+                            match $func(dev, &*guard, data, file) {
```

All driver ioctl handlers gain a `_adev`/`_pdev` parameter they don't use yet (prefixed with `_`). Nova and Tyr driver changes are mechanical.
